About E. Wilkinson

E. Wilkinson is a scholar working on General Health Professions,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ging, Critical Care and Intensive Care Medicine and Internal Medicine, having authored 18 papers that have together received 318 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Radiology practices and education (4 papers), Ultrasound in Clinical Applications (3 papers), Venous Thromboembolism Diagnosis and Management (3 papers), Global Health Workforce Issues (2 papers), Interpreting and Communication in Healthcare (2 papers), Radiation Dose and Imaging (2 papers), Innovations in Medical Education (2 papers) and Cultural Competency in Health Care (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health (161 citations), Internal Medicine (19 citations), General Health Professions (92 citations), Occupational Therapy (13 citations) and Geriatrics and Gerontology (11 citations). E. Wilkinson has collaborated with scholars based in United Kingdom, Qatar and Australia. Frequent co-authors include Chris Salisbury, Nick Bosanquet, A Naysmith, Peter Franks, Maria Lorentzon, Jay Gordonson, Malcolm C. Pike, Erin E. Young, Gurch Randhawa and Susan M. Cooper. Their work appears in journals such as Palliative Medicine, JNCI Journal of the National Cancer Institute, Journal of Wound Care, Veterinary Record and Diabetic Medicine.
